Description
n-Boc-Indole-2-Boronic Acid CAS NO 213318-44-6 is a high-purity, protected boronic acid derivative essential for modern synthetic organic chemistry. This compound serves as a critical building block in cross-coupling reactions, enabling the efficient construction of complex indole-based molecular architectures. It is primarily utilized by pharmaceutical R&D teams and fine chemical manufacturers for the development of active pharmaceutical ingredients (APIs), agrochemicals, and advanced materials.
Application
- Pharmaceutical Intermediate: A key precursor in the synthesis of novel drug candidates, particularly those targeting neurological and oncological pathways.
- Suzuki-Miyaura Cross-Coupling Reactions: Serves as a versatile boronic acid partner for constructing biaryl and heterobiaryl systems under mild conditions.
- Agrochemical Research: Used in the development of new herbicides, fungicides, and plant growth regulators with indole scaffolds.
- Material Science: Employed in the creation of organic semiconductors, ligands for catalysis, and functional polymers.
- Academic & Contract Research: A valuable reagent for methodology development and library synthesis in academic and CRO laboratories.
- Peptide Mimetics & PROTACs: Facilitates the introduction of indole motifs into complex molecules like peptide mimetics and proteolysis-targeting chimeras.
Basic Information
| Product Name | n-Boc-Indole-2-Boronic Acid |
| CAS No. | 213318-44-6 |
| Molecular Formula | C₁₃H₁₆BNO₄ |
| Molecular Weight | 261.09 g/mol |
| Synonyms | 2-Borono-1H-indole-1-carboxylic acid, 1,1-dimethylethyl ester; 1-Boc-indole-2-boronic acid; tert-Butyl 2-borono-1H-indole-1-carboxylate; 1-(tert-Butoxycarbonyl)-1H-indole-2-boronic acid; N-Boc-2-indoleboronic acid; Boc-Indole-2-B(OH)₂; 1-Boc-2-indolylboronic acid; 2-Boron-N-Boc-indole |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ry place at 2-8°C or as specified on the label. This material is hygroscopic (moisture-sensitive) and should be handled under an inert atmosphere (e.g., nitrogen or argon) for long-term storage and to prevent degradation. Keep away from incompatible materials.
